(a)
We get the time taken to reach the maximum height by using the vertical component of the velocity:
v=u+at
∴ 0=25sin60−9.8t
∴ t=21.65/9.8=2.21s
By inference the return to earth will take the same time, assuming a level playing field.
∴ total time in flight =2×2.21=4.42s
(b)
The horizontal component of velocity is constant so we get:
Distance = speed x time=25cos60×4.42=55.25m
